引言

在数字货币和区块链技术不断发展的今天,数据分析变得尤为重要。TokenPocket 是一款广受欢迎的数字货币,它不仅支持多种链上交易,还提供了简洁易用的用户界面。对于投资者和开发者来说,抓取链上数据,进行深入分析,对于制定投资策略和技术研究极为关键。本教程将详细介绍如何使用 TokenPocket 抓包,并提供实用的技巧与工具,帮助你更好地理解和应用数据。

一、什么是抓包?

TokenPocket 抓包教程:轻松掌握如何分析链上数据

抓包,顾名思义,就是对网络上传输的数据进行捕获和分析的过程。它可以帮助我们深入理解应用程序和网络间的通信,尤其是在区块链领域。通过抓包,开发者和研究人员可以获取交易数据、用户行为等信息,并据此进行各种分析。

在区块链领域,抓包的技术可以帮助我们了解交易流动性、用户的选择和行为模式,从而更好地制定策略。尤其是在使用像 TokenPocket 这样的多链时,掌握抓包的技巧能让你获得更深层次的洞见。

二、TokenPocket 抓包的准备工作

在进行抓包之前,你需要准备好相应的工具和环境。以下是一些必要的准备工作:

  1. 下载并安装抓包工具:目前市面上有许多抓包工具可供选择,最常用的包括 Fiddler、Charles Proxy 和 Wireshark。选择你熟悉的工具进行安装。
  2. 设置设备代理:为了能够捕获 TokenPocket 的网络请求,需要将你的设备的网络设置为使用抓包工具的代理。通常需要在设备的 Wi-Fi 设置中找到相应的代理选项,手动输入抓包工具的 IP 地址和端口号。
  3. 获取 SSL 证书:很多区块链的通信会通过 HTTPS 协议加密。在使用抓包工具时,你需要安装相应的 SSL 证书,以便工具能够解密这些数据。确保在抓包工具中遵循安装指引,完成 SSL 证书的安装。

三、抓取 TokenPocket 数据的步骤

TokenPocket 抓包教程:轻松掌握如何分析链上数据

下面是具体的抓包步骤,将帮助你获得 TokenPocket 中的链上交易数据:

  1. 启动抓包工具:完成以上准备后,启动你的抓包工具并确保它正在监听你的网络流量。
  2. 连接 TokenPocket:打开 TokenPocket 并进行必要的操作,如交易、查询资产等。此时,抓包工具应该可以捕捉到 TokenPocket 的所有网络请求。
  3. 筛选请求:利用抓包工具提供的过滤功能,筛选出与 TokenPocket 相关的请求,以便更容易进行分析。关注包含“api”、“tx”、“wallet”等关键词的请求。
  4. 分析数据:双击你感兴趣的请求,查看请求和响应的详细信息。这些信息通常包括请求的 URL、请求方法、请求头、请求体以及返回的数据。
  5. 保存数据:如果需要,你可以将抓取到的数据导出为文件,以备日后分析和参考。

四、解析抓包数据的技巧

抓取到的数据通常是原始的,解析和理解这些数据是关键。以下是一些解析抓包数据的实用技巧:

  • 使用 JSON 格式化工具:如果返回的数据是 JSON 格式,可以使用在线 JSON 格式化工具(如 JSONLint)对其进行格式化,以便于阅读和分析。
  • 分析交易内容:对于与交易相关的数据,重点关注字段如“from”、“to”、“value”、“gas”等,这些信息有助于你理解交易的流量和方向。
  • 记录异常数据:在分析过程中,注意寻找那些与正常行为不符的异常数据,这可能是某些安全问题或攻击的线索。
  • 交叉验证信息:抓包的同时,不妨交叉验证不同的数据来源,如区块链浏览器(如 Etherscan 或 BscScan)及社区讨论,这能提高信息的准确性和完整性。

五、常见问题解答

在进行抓包和数据分析的过程中,用户往往会遇到一些问题。以下是四个常见问题的解答,帮助你更好地掌握 TokenPocket 的抓包技巧。

抓包数据丢失了怎么办?

在抓包过程中,偶尔会遇到数据丢失的情况。这可能是由于网络不稳定、抓包工具设置不当等原因造成的。为了避免这种情况,你可以采取以下措施:

  1. 确保网络连接稳定:在进行抓包前,确保你的网络连接健康。一个不稳定的网络可能导致请求未能正常发送或接收。
  2. 检查抓包工具设置:确认你的抓包工具设置正确,尤其是代理和 SSL 证书,错误的配置可能会导致数据无法捕获。
  3. 适时重启抓包工具:有时候工具可能出现故障,适时重启可以解决一些问题。
  4. 使用备份方案:可以同时使用多个抓包工具,以增加数据获取的成功率。在一个工具捕获失败时,另一个可以补充。

抓到的数据怎么分析?

抓取到数据后,分析是接下来的关键步骤。你可以以下几个方面进行分析:

  1. 关注数据类型:首先确定抓取到的数据属于哪种类型(如交易、用户行为、系统请求),不同类型的数据分析方法和目的不同。
  2. 做趋势分析:将抓取到的数据进行整理,使用图表工具生成可视化数据,便于观察数据的变化趋势和异常情况。
  3. 结合外部信息:将抓取的数据与市场情况、区块链浏览器的实时数据结合,进行综合分析能够产出更有价值的信息。
  4. 撰写分析报告:为确保信息的传递有效,将你的分析结果写成报告,以便团队或个人未来的决策参考。

抓包工具的选择有哪些注意事项?

在选择抓包工具时,以下几个因素需要考虑:

  1. 易用性:选择一个用户友好的工具,可以帮助你更快上手。对于初学者来说,较为简洁的界面和直观的操作是重要的考量。
  2. 功能性:确保抓包工具支持 SSL 解密和多协议抓包等高级功能,这对于分析区块链数据非常重要。
  3. 兼容性:确认工具与你的操作系统兼容,确保没有性能问题。
  4. 社区支持:选择那些有强大用户社区支持的工具,这能确保在遇到问题时,有足够的资源可以参考和获取帮助。

如何保障抓包过程中的数据隐私?

抓包过程中,数据隐私是个重要问题。以下是几种保障数据隐私的措施:

  1. 避免抓取敏感数据:在抓包过程中,尽量避免捕获个人信息或敏感数据。如果需要获取敏感信息,请确保遵循相关法律法规。
  2. 使用加密工具:在数据传输时,可以借助加密工具提高数据的安全性,确保即使数据被截获,也不会轻易被理解。
  3. 适当清理历史数据:抓包工具通常会保存历史数据,确保定期清理这些数据,防止信息泄露。
  4. 控制访问权限:限制抓包工具的使用权限,确保只有授权的人员才能访问和分析抓取的数据。

总结

TokenPocket 作为一个多功能的区块链,其提供的丰富数据,对于开发者和投资者均具有重要的价值。通过掌握抓包技巧,我们能够更深入地了解链上交易,分析用户行为,为未来的决策提供数据支持。希望本教程中的内容以及常见问题解答能够对你有所帮助,助你在区块链分析的道路上走得更远。

无论你是开发者还是普通用户,懂得如何抓包和分析数据,都会帮助你更好地参与到这个快速发展的数字货币世界中。未来,在区块链技术不断演变的背景下,数据分析的重要性将愈加凸显。更多的链上数据分析工具和技术也会不断涌现,保持对这个领域的关注和学习将是非常必要的。